MATX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

294 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Matsons (MATX)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$1.77B — down 9.3% from $1.95B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 46 funds closed out of MATX and 40 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 130 trimmed existing stakes and 89 added.

The largest buyer was Dimensional Fund Advisors, adding an estimated $15.9M. The largest seller was ArrowMark Colorado Holdings, cutting an estimated $43M.
